Over the centuries, countless men and women have dedicated their lives to the protection of animals, and their legacy is honored in the form of statues, plaques, fountains, parks, benches, monuments, poems, organizations, stories, and memories. In today's podcast episode, I continue our journey into the stories of remarkable individuals who pioneered the modern-day animal protection movement in the United States — the lives and legacies of these compassionate trailblazers who tirelessly fought for the welfare and rights of animals.
